Position Title: Banquet Manager

Reports To: Director of Catering

Salary: $70,000 to $80,000

Other Forms of Compensation:

Founded in 2005 as Hudson Yards Catering, Union Square Events is a culinary and operations leader in the hospitality industry, partnering with a diverse portfolio of best-in-class clients. We produce one-of-a-kind catered events and unparalleled dining experiences in a variety of cultural, corporate, entertainment, and private venues throughout New York City and beyond.

Job Summary

Working as a Banquet Manager, you will manage the event planning and operations from start to finish, offering personalized solutions for our clients and work with our operations team to make sure we exceed our client's expectations.

Key Responsibilities:


Oversee and manage all aspects of the Banquet/event operations, assigned to run banquet functions and other areas of the department base on business needs

• Coordinate between Front of House and Culinary teams to ensure smooth communication and successful event execution.

• Manage fleet operations, ensuring safe and timely transportation of equipment and supplies for off-premise events.


• Serve as the direct liaison between the event teams, ensuring seamless transitions and problem-solving on the day of events.

• Maintain the organization and upkeep of all event equipment and resources, ensuring all tools and materials are readily available and in working condition.

  • Coordinates and oversees internal and external catering events
  • Develops and maintains the catering marketing plan including a comprehensive event planning service to clients and detailed menu development
  • Hires, trains, and schedules catering staff, and will be actively involved in the development of existing catering staff in service techniques, menu presentation, policies, and procedures
  • Ensures successful operations of catering functions including labor cost control, foods cost control and preparation, transportation, setup, operation, and cleanup of all events
  • Books, selects and costs menu items, pricing contracts, and resourcing temporary help and equipment experience is key

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ree is required in Hospitality or Culinary Arts, Bachelor's degree Preferred
  • Minimum of five years of experience in hospitality industry including four years in management (preferably Catering Management) is required
  • The ability to supervise food preparation, service and clean up is also essential
  • ServSafe Certified a plus
  • Must have a valid clean driving license
